Overview
Provides Technical Support to Field Representatives & Customers for Safran HE engines in service – Maintains visibility on Performance & Reliability of Safran HE engines in service
Responsibilities- Deliver expert-level technical support to Field Representatives and customers through phone consultations, email correspondence, and on-site engagements, ensuring timely resolution of complex issues.
- Draft, validate, and authorize technical agreements under design office delegation, aligning with regulatory standards and engineering best practices.
- Lead root cause investigations for in-service incidents, producing comprehensive analytical reports that inform corrective actions and enhance operational safety.
- Drive continuous improvement in engine maintainability, initiating updates to maintenance procedures that optimize performance and reduce downtime.
- Analyze Health Monitoring data and engine parameters to troubleshoot engine fault codes/issues in-service and/or provide maintenance recommendations as required.
- Perform advanced data analysis on engine removals and reliability metrics to identify systemic trends, propose actionable solutions and support fleet-wide reliability enhancements.
- Ensure product safety, reliability and improvement through the above-mentioned activities.
